Default Re: AQs Makes Two Pair on 4 Flush Board

I think you played the hand fine. Going for the flop checkraise is fine, since you likely have the best hand and the preflop 3 bettor will usually bet this flop every time no matter what he has. Turn play is standard. And on the river I can see why you called getting 10-1 pot odds. It seems obvious that the turn aggressor has a flush, but I still think this is a call online getting 10-1 simply becuz there are so many idiots out there that will pop this turn with Ad6d and still bet the river hoping you will fold. With no read I think it is ok to call this river, I have called many rivers in seemingly hopeless situations like these online and to be honest I am suprised at how often i did win.
